Vulnerability in Zyxel P2000w Version 2 Voip Wifi Phone
CVE-2006-0302
ZyXel P2000W VoIP 802.11b Wireless Phone running firmware WV.00.02 allows remote attackers to obtain sensitive information, such as MAC address and software version, by directly accessing UDP port 9090.
